Applications of Fast Time-of-Flight System

2012 
Abstract The next-generation of fast time-of-flight detectors, with expected time resolutions ≤ 10 ps and space resolutions ≤ 1 mm, are attractive in many fields, including particle and nuclear physics, medical and industrial applications. We show how precise timing and space resolution can be used to improve muon cooling measurement for muon collider studies, TOF spectrometry, and particle identification in general collider detectors. Results of simulation studies are presented.
